For this one, I stamped the spooky bat tree and for some reason, I cut out the moon. On a small piece of marigold card stock, I sponged on orange and red ink and attached it behind the cut out moon. I know it would have looked just fine if I'd colored the original moon. But that would have been...I don't know...quick and easy. If things are too quick and easy, I start to think I'm doing something wrong.
I stamped the greeting and punched the lower edge, then attached it to a black layer. I used a black marker to edge the next white layer then attached it to a 5.5 x 4.25 white card. I cut out the goofy bat and punched a few smaller bats and added them. Still pretty quick and easy...despite my efforts to the contrary, lol.
